Transaction 2c664360e67da48964f66b9ffa0530089ca7cd702f00409bf2b5c7e4dd4ffbaa
1 Input
1 Output
-
2c664360e67da48964f66b9ffa0530089ca7cd702f00409bf2b5c7e4dd4ffbaa:0
- value
- 516609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 707a6a97772de702906826f8b9362a6614a0ab34 OP_EQUAL
- address
- 3BwkFffnS2VAdPmMhYParwhCSqPJPu4taE